Work Experience / Internship


Ideal: the combination of language training and professional activity.
Language in an everyday professional environment: this is the magic formula if you want to intensify your linguistic ability and simultaneously gain new professional experience. With work experience in England and Canada and internship in the USA Eurocentres offers you the opportunity of doing exactly this, in collaboration with specialists in the field. You get a sense of international business environment, get to know professional colleagues from another country, extend your language and career horizons and thus improve your chances on the job market.
This is what you need to know about your Work Experience/Internship.
* Minimum age: England and Canada 28, USA 28
* Language ability: at least Level 5 on the Eurocentres Scale
* Experience of work, vocational training or higher education is an advantage
* The pattern is the same in all three countries: your Work Experience/ Internship course follows your Eurocentres language course and is the same length as the language course. The two separate elements (language course; Work Experience/Internship) are booked at the same time.
* Visa: When you enrol, you will receive the information about the necessary conditions, plus the necessary forms, from our Work Experience partner. In the USA: if you have already found a place for your practical training yourself, we can still help you with the completion of the necessary visa formalities.
* Enrolment: at least 3 months (UK, Canada) or 6 months (USA) before the start of the relevant Work Experience/Internship.
In what types of companies is Work placement/Intership available?
Our partner organisations have numerous contacts with successful companies and years of experience. They will give you individual advice and can usually offer you a placement in the field you want. The condition is that you have completed training or have professional experience in that field.
Where are the companies which are offering work placements?
In England: in the region around London and in South England. In the USA: in all the states.
What about earnings?
Most companies do not pay wages, although some may provide a little pocket money or a contribution to daily travel.
What can you expect from your host companies?
You will gain valuable professional experience and be able to improve your language ability. The company will draw up a suitable work programme with you. Your contact person will carefully introduce you to your work. At the end of the placement, you are given a certification about your employment.
Where will you live?
Our partner organisations help you to look for accommodation: with a host family, in a hotel or a Student Residence.
Who is your contractual partner?
Eurocentres acts as a mediator. You conclude the contract with the Eurocentres partner.
